One participant in another discussion, on IRC, stated the other night that he had some strange 3,5mm screws he could not place in the normal metric system.

I countered with the observation that yes, M3,5 does exist, in several pitches, but the Occam's Razor guess, given that he works with computers, would be UNC #6-32. This he had not considered, at all.

Well I went down a keyboard rabbit hole and look what I found: https://github.com/qmk/qmk_firmware/tree/master/keyboards/durgod/k320

Yes K320 is a standard STM32 board which has been reverse engineered and has third party firmware available. Hold down B+L on the keyboard at plug in and it goes into DFU mode. Can reflash the original firmware then as well. So basically:

1. Standard key tops
2. Standard CPU
3. Standard firmware
4. Standard key switches.

This thing should last near forever even if I break it  :-+

Had a bit more of a play with the Tektronix 492BP spectrum analyser.
Highest frequency source I had handy was a little 5.6 GHz DRO oscillator brick from a telemetry system.  The SA shows it as spot on with no drift and correct level. The 2nd harmonic at 11.2GHz is showing too. All looking good. Not bad for £675.
Many years ago I designed a demodulator for the 10MHz IF output as part of the day job. I'll have to see if I can find the circuit. I did not keep the prototype as I never thought I would have a spectrum analyser that cost as much as the flat I'd just bought  :-DD

Oh I may have ordered another desktop PC as LTspice on the Mac is about as fun as pissing out caltrops  :palm:.

Until macOS went 64 bit only the PC version of LTSpice ran happily under WINE. What broke was WINE, not LTSpice per se. The people behind the commercial WINE for macOS, CodeWeavers, were working on 64 bit support for WINE on macOS which was scheduled to make it back into the upstream - it may be there by now, I haven't checked for a while. I gave their pay-to-play product (CrossOver, £32) a spin with the trial version and it worked.
